58 lines
1.3 KiB
YAML
58 lines
1.3 KiB
YAML
|
|
router:
|
|
removeExtraSlashes: true
|
|
routes:
|
|
home-route:
|
|
pattern: '/'
|
|
path:
|
|
controller: index
|
|
action: index
|
|
about-route:
|
|
pattern: '/about'
|
|
path:
|
|
controller: index
|
|
action: about
|
|
cb-created:
|
|
pattern: '/callback/created/{id}'
|
|
path:
|
|
controller: callback
|
|
action: created
|
|
cb-endpoint:
|
|
pattern: '/cb/{id}/:params'
|
|
path:
|
|
controller: api
|
|
action: endpoint
|
|
login:
|
|
pattern: '/login'
|
|
path:
|
|
controller: auth
|
|
action: index
|
|
logout:
|
|
pattern: '/logout'
|
|
path:
|
|
controller: auth
|
|
action: logout
|
|
oauth:
|
|
pattern: '/login/{strategy:([a-z]+)}/:params'
|
|
path:
|
|
controller: auth
|
|
action: oauth
|
|
oauth-disconnect:
|
|
pattern: '/oauth/{provider:([a-z]+)}/disconnect'
|
|
path: 'User::oauthdisconnect'
|
|
oauth-disconnect-confirm:
|
|
pattern: '/oauth/{provider:([a-z]+)}/disconnect/{confirm}'
|
|
path: 'User::oauthdisconnect'
|
|
user-register:
|
|
pattern: '/register'
|
|
path: Auth::register
|
|
user-settings:
|
|
pattern: '/settings'
|
|
path:
|
|
controller: user
|
|
action: settings
|
|
activation-link:
|
|
pattern: '/activate/{link}'
|
|
path:
|
|
controller: api
|
|
action: activationlink
|